Resilient Leadership — Optimizing Cybersecurity in a Dynamic World

Chris Boehm
Field CTO
Zero Networks
The rapid evolution of cyber threats and technological advancements over the past year has introduced both unprecedented challenges and opportunities for organizations worldwide. Now more than ever, cybersecurity leaders must drive organizational success by integrating security initiatives with business objectives.
Gartner predicts that by 2027, nearly half of CISOs will expand their remit beyond cybersecurity, due to increasing regulatory pressure and attack surface expansion. To meet this moment, security leaders must adopt strategic leadership approaches that leverage collaboration and innovation to optimize cybersecurity investments, enhance resilience, and drive organizational growth -- all while navigating and defending against increasingly more sophisticated and high-frequency attacks.
